Output 82c8979dc93a1704c7d3187a16caccf2b3e7c312e355644dd0e383e1cc642e01:28

value
13923551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ebcd046ca1eaaf158e4505577bb24ffacf06e6b1 OP_EQUAL
address
MVPxdMtBuhfSTptHZ1jBDoPK2cQmpgpuBj
transaction
82c8979dc93a1704c7d3187a16caccf2b3e7c312e355644dd0e383e1cc642e01
spent
true